How Industrial RO Systems Relate to These Issues
Industrial Reverse Osmosis (RO) systems are advanced water treatment technologies designed to remove a wide range of contaminants from water. They work by forcing water through a semi-permeable membrane, which filters out dissolved salts, particles, and other impurities. In the context of Brunswick's water challenges, industrial RO systems are particularly valuable because they:
- Effectively reduce TDS levels, protecting industrial equipment from damage.
- Remove heavy metals and organic contaminants, improving water purity.
- Help control microbial contamination by filtering out microorganisms.
